Incident Summary:

06/05/2009: On Friday night at approximately 0300, in Psychico north of Athens, Greece, an improvised explosive device exploded outside the Tax Bureau office on Kifissias Avenue, causing minor damage to the government office but no injuries. Armed Revolutionary Action claimed responsibility.
